    I'm spending some down time at Tahoe outta the heat, but I needed to take a important meeting with one of my big bosses outta LA, so I told him to land the plane in Minden. It's the nearest practical airport to me. South Lake Tahoe is too busy and at high altitude as is the Truckee airport. I takes more experience to deal with the high altitude. The Taildragger Cafe is right here at the Minden Airport. Basically walking distance from where you can park the plane. The food here is very popular breakfast food, but they do serve all day till dinner even. Service is super friendly and efficient. The inside has I good view of the airport runways and planes. The full menu is posted online on their FB page. We had some lunch and did our meeting. I had a cheeseburger with fries and my boss had the Citation sandwich, which was roast beef with cheese and caramelized onions. My burger came with fries and we shared an order of onion rings. My burger was pretty good, cooked med rare as ordered. Pretty standard burger. My boss liked his Citation sandwich with the caramelized onions. The onion rings were decent as well. He had coffee too, and it was kept full and hot by the server. I'm glad this little restaurant is out here at the airport, it's a good place to have if you fly in and need food right away. The little airport I have in Redding has a Chinese restaurant with a view of the runways! I'll take little airports over big ones any day!

    I'd heard that this little airport located between Minden and Carson had fantastic breakfast. Just take Airport Road from US395 and go east. Follow it to the end and there you are. Lots of parking, at least when I went. The dining area has lots of light from the outside with views of the planes and tarmac. I guess if you have a plane you can land here and just park and walk into the cafe and go fly off to somewhere else to eat. The friendly server was right over and served coffee. Looking over the menu, I ordered a build my own omelet ($10.50) with cheese, spinach, mushrooms and sausage. $10.50 is a good price for any omelet these days and these here are FOUR egg omelets. I got hashbrowns and toast too. Wow, when my breakfast arrived, it was huge! The omelet was stuffed high and had lots of chopped sausage in it .... heavy on the meat ... OK! The hashbrowns were some of the most perfect and tasty hashbrowns I ever had! The toast was buttered nice, but you do have to request jelly as it's not on the table like most places ... maybe too many customers stealing jelly off the table! I'll say, people were right saying this Taildragger Cafe has some great breakfast and low prices too!
